    Portable Water Filtering System (Product is busy being updated to the one in the video)

     

    The system was designed by FilterShop to address a problem the owners often faced when going on vacation, finding good drinking water. As many of us know the quality and taste of water varies greatly as you travel from area to area. Some areas the water has certain bacteria in that the locals are used to but your digestive track might have some issues with it. While other areas the water might taste dramatically different to what you're used to, this is normally due to a dramatic change in the mineral composition of the water, this could mean that the water tastes brackish (high salt levels) or have high levels of lime (kalk, or Hardness).

     
    This system is designed to be able to take almost any water source and create good quality drinking water
     
     

    Benefits:

     
    •        Built into a standard ammunition crate that is easy to transport
    •     Works on most water sources.
    •     Modular thus can be easily maintained if the need arises
    •     The abilities of the system vary depending on how you use it but it can:
      • Can run with no electricity if the source water is pressurized
      • If the water pressure is low as in the case of a tank in a trailer the system can run from either 12 volt via a built in pump.
      • If there is no water pressure the system's pump can be primed via an included hand pump or primed with the electric pump.
      • The system can remove salt, lime, bacteria, viruses, water borne parasites, and even heavy metals.
      • The system has two barriers that prevent bacteria from passing through thus making it much safer than conventional filter systems
     

    Keep In Mind:

    •  The system needs a relitivly clear quality of the source water 
    •  It is very important to make sure that the filters are always in good condition as this will affect your product water
    •  The chance is small but there is some water that even this system won’t be able to deal with such as extremely high salt levels (over 1000 TDS) or extremely high bacteria levels or visibly dirty water.
    •  When operating the system will waste at least 4 times as much water as it produces in order to prevent the Reverse Osmosis (RO) membrane from becoming blocked

     

     How does it work?

     

    Basically, the system starts with three filters; a Inline sediment filter followed by a Combination KDF, Carbon, and Ultra Filtration Filter This is Similar to the set of filters that is used in our Triple Under Counter Filter System. Between them, they remove chlorine, smells, dirt and most importantly Bacteria. You can click on the names of the filters to read more about what each individual filter does. This level of filtration is sufficient for most places where the water supply is municipal water that tastes acceptable. Then the Water passes through a Reverse Osmosis membrane that will reduce the mineral content and act as a second barrier for bacteria. It is similar to the Silver RO system.
     
    We recommend taking a Total Dissolved Solids (TDS) Meter along too as it is used to measure the amount of minerals in the water and thus helps you get an idea of the mineral content of the water. If it is over 300 you would expect very slow filtration and if it is over 1000 the filters will not last long.
     
    This level of filtration is however a slow process with a maximum capacity of about 12 Liters Per Hour, and it will waste about 4 times that to keep the final filter from clogging. This process also requires a minimum pressure of 3 bar, thus in many situations, you will need to use the booster pump. You can click on RO for more information on the process.
